Studies on VA medical foster homes show good outcomes for Vets


Listen Later

Mitch Mirkin of VA Research Communications interviews Dr. Cari Levy, chief of palliative care at the Denver VA Medical Center and associate director of the Center of Innovation for Veteran-Centered and Value-Driven Research. Levy talks about the concept of the VA medical foster home, and explains what her studies have shown regarding this innovative model of long-term care for Veterans. VA medical foster homes are private family homes in which trained caregivers provides 24/7 services to no more than three individuals. The homes go through a rigorous inspection and approval process.
